Description

Built of coursed red sandstone rubble with Welsh slate roof. Two storey mill with a single storey three bay cart shed attached at the bottom end, the whole converted to housing (1998-9). The yard side has two doors and two windows on the ground floor and four windows and a taking-in door above, with a variety of shapes and sizes. The cart shed has part glazed/part timber infill to the three elliptical arches and three rooflights above. Rear wall of the cart shed is blind. The mill has two doors and two windows to the ground floor and six windows above, all 2-light 2 + 2 casements in elliptical heads. Roofs of low pitch.

Interior not seen at re-survey, but the building has been converted to domestic use.
